Think About Temperature
Will your fine art items need to be stored for any length of time? If so, make sure you talk to your moving company about proper climate controlled storage. Moisture can be quite damaging to paintings and prints.
Ask About Logistics
Your moving company should be able to tell you and show you what type of crates or packing they will use to move your fine art. Paintings should be crated. For sculptures, your movers should review each piece on a case by case basis due to the size and dynamics of each piece. Ask about how they will move in each piece – will they fit through doors, how will pieces be moved up stairs, etc. If a sculpture can be taken apart, it should be.
